OSP K9 Naming Contest
(Salem, OR) -- Oregon State Police are asking school kids to help name their new K-9. The two-year-old Belgian Malinois is a drug detection dog that will work out of the Albany Patrol Office. Kids from kindergarten through fifth grade can take part. The entries will be narrowed to five names and the winning student will get to meet the dog and get prizes. The school with the most participation will also be recognized by OSP.
